An overview of regular dialysis treatment in Japan (as of 31 December 2012).

TL;DR: The dialysis patient population has been growing every year in Japan; it was 310 007 at the end of 2012, which exceeded 310’000 for the first time, and the percentage of dialysis patients with diabetic nephropathy has been continuously increasing, whereas not only the percentage but also the actual number of dial renal failure patients with chronic glomerulonephritis has decreased.

Elevated Non-high-density Lipoprotein Cholesterol (Non-HDL-C) Predicts Atherosclerotic Cardiovascular Events in Hemodialysis Patients

TL;DR: Dyslipidemia was associated with increased risk of incident atherosclerotic CVD, and protein energy wasting/inflammation with increasedrisk of death after CVD events in this hemodialysis cohort.
